I received a parking ticket and the car registration on the ticket is not mine. i.e one digit is wrong. Does this render the ticket invalid and do i have to pay it or can i just ignore it, surely the council wont be able to chase payment without the correct registration number?
They will either:
a) send the NTO to the owner of that reg. no
b) realise their mistake and bin the ticket, since they cannot re-issue a corrected ticket for the same contravention0 -

Dont be surprised though if the councils realise their mistake and try to issue new pcn's when they look at the photos....it has been known.
However they are not allowed to reissue the ticket so would be an easy win if it ever got as far as appeal.You may click thanks if you found my advice useful0 -
